Cheng-gong acquires the Telepathy Skill but lacking in strength, he fails to defeat Ao Bai. Chief Priest Chiu Yeh warns Cheng-gong not to be too eager for success and advises him to gather Tzu-lung's former men to jointly deal with Ao Bai. Hsueh-yi is still devoted to Cheng-gong thus she rejects Chung-yuan's love for her, much to his disappointment. The bandit, Silver Tiger, has wishful thinking on Hsueh-yi and one day he purposely draws Chung-yuan away in an attempt to rape Hsueh-yi. Fortunately, Chung-yuan returns in time to stop the act. Since Hsien Hsia Gate is taken over, Su-shan roams beyond the city to avoid the Manchus. Several year later, Su-shan and her group sneak back to Mainland and find that the Manchus have extended their power to the south, such that the anti-Manchu groups find it difficult to organize themselves to chase the enemy away……
